Transaction 925bddee976f320765a03ab0a7c664d38005537c211ea137a881e7032296e184
1 Input
1 Output
-
925bddee976f320765a03ab0a7c664d38005537c211ea137a881e7032296e184:0
- value
- 1668487
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bd62300ee54423b2453fb8a1a4733e951af1980
- address
- bc1qr0tzxq8w23prkfznlw9p53ena9g67xvqskwzfn